MilSim weekend warriors are not enlisted in the military, however many of them tend to be retired or ex military. Being enlisted is not a requirement in this army. Airsoft guns and MilSim games are war simulation using airsoft guns. Air soft guns are weapons that fire small rubber pellets, and are powered by forced air. Airsoft MilSim is not the only way you can play military simulation games. You can decide to play online or you can join a group of paintball warriors, but if you want the most realistic form of military simulation than you should invest in an airsoft gun and join the local club. Airsoft guns are exact replicas of real firearms, in most cases military weapons such as m16's. These guns which got their start in Asia have become popular in the U. S. And involve some sort of forced air firing mechanism. These guns can be gas powered, battery powered or hand pump weapons. Players must be honest when it comes to be shot at. Unlike paintball guns these weapons do not use paint loaded pellets and consequently do not leave paint splatters when they strike a target. However it is airsoft guns close resemblance to the original weapons that help them be so popular. An authentic look and feel allows players to feel like they are really at war. Many organizations require particular uniforms and use military radios and even eat military rations while out in the battlefield. These groups consist of different ranks and these ranks are typically marked on the players arm much as they would be in the military. These military style exercises may last all weekend and may involve large groups of soldiers. It is common for players to remain out in the playing field the entire time, only leaving if there is an emergency such as a serious injury.
